Description

Chosera sharpening stones are used for sharpening knives on guided knife sharpeners. Chosera is a high-end series from Naniwa made of aluminum oxide with magnesia binder. The magnesia binder gives Chosera excellent sharpening quality and performance, and high wear resistance.

All Chosera stones are 6mm thick and are mounted on high-quality aluminum blanks.

Chosera series stones are universal and can be used to sharpen knives of any steel including high carbon, vanadium, and chromium steels.

Chosera should be used with water as a lubricant. Do not soak Chosera stones in water for more than a few seconds. Just splash, or use a water spray. Never store stones in water. Never dry near heat.

Attention. To reach the best result for the first sharpening session, stone lapping is recommended. Lapping is optional. During break-in period (no lapping), exposed irregularities will go away and the surface becomes smooth.
